#FC790C Hex Color Code

#FC790C

The Hexadecimal Color #FC790C is a contrast shade of Dark Orange. #FC790C RGB value is rgb(252, 121, 12). RGB Color Model of #FC790C consists of 98% red, 47% green and 4% blue. HSL color Mode of #FC790C has 27°(degrees) Hue, 98% Saturation and 52% Lightness. #FC790C color has an wavelength of 603n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#FC790C is #FF9933.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#FC790C is #F71. The Closest Color to #FC790C is #FF8C00. Official Name of #FC790C Hex Code is Sorbus.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#FC790C is 0 Cyan 52 Magenta 95 Yellow 1 Black and #FC790C CMY is 0, 52, 95.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#FC790C is hsl(27,98,52,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(27, 95, 99).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#FC790C is 47.05, 34.4, 4.51.
Hex8 Value of #FC790C is #FC790CFF. Decimal Value of #FC790C is 16546060 and Octal Value of #FC790C is 77074414. Binary Value of #FC790C is 11111100, 1111001, 1100 and Android of #FC790C is 4294736140 / 0xfffc790c.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#FC790C is 0.547, 0.4, 0.4 and YIQ Color Space of #FC790C is 147.743, 113.0846, -6.2143.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#FC790C is 48.52, 25.32, 5.04.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#FC790C is 65.28, 45.19, 70.94.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#FC790C is 65.28, 109.11, 58.22.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#FC790C is 65.28, 84.11, 57.5. Hunter Lab variable of #FC790C is 58.65, 40.55, 36.5.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#FC790C

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
